1. Shaniwar Wada

- Highlights: Historical significance, stunning architecture, light-and-sound show
- Best Time to Visit: Evening for the light-and-sound show
Shaniwar Wada is a historical fortification in the heart of Pune. Once the seat of the Peshwa rulers, this iconic landmark offers insights into the city’s glorious Maratha history. The fort’s intricate architecture and beautiful gardens make it a perfect spot for history buffs. The fort is also famous for its light-and-sound show in the evening, which recounts the history of the Peshwa dynasty.
2. Aga Khan Palace

- Highlights: Historical significance, gardens, museum
- Best Time to Visit: Morning for a serene experience
Aga Khan Palace is a majestic building with historical importance, known for its association with Mahatma Gandhi and the Indian freedom struggle. The palace features beautiful gardens and houses a museum showcasing artifacts from India’s independence movement. In January, the weather makes it a great place to explore the grand architecture and serene surroundings.
3. Sinhagad Fort

- Highlights: Trekking, panoramic views, historical ruins
- Best Time to Visit: Early morning for a refreshing trek
For those who enjoy nature and history, Sinhagad Fort is a must-visit destination. Located on a hilltop, the fort offers panoramic views of the surrounding valley and is famous for its role in Maratha history. January’s cool weather makes it an excellent time for trekking and exploring the fort’s historical ruins and scenic landscapes.

5. Osho Ashram

- Highlights: Meditation, spiritual atmosphere, wellness retreats
- Best Time to Visit: Morning or evening for meditation sessions
For a spiritual experience, visit the Osho Ashram, also known as the Osho International Meditation Resort. The ashram offers a peaceful atmosphere where visitors can meditate, relax, and rejuvenate. January’s pleasant weather makes it a perfect time to spend a day here, taking part in meditation sessions or simply enjoying the serene environment.

7. Pune-Okayama Friendship Garden

- Highlights: Japanese landscaping, water features, peaceful atmosphere
- Best Time to Visit: Morning for a tranquil experience
The Pune-Okayama Friendship Garden is a beautifully landscaped Japanese garden that offers a peaceful escape from the city’s hustle and bustle. The serene environment, with its beautiful greenery, water features, and Japanese architecture, makes it a perfect spot for relaxation and leisure walks. The pleasant January weather adds to the charm of the garden.
8. Bund Garden

- Highlights: Boat rides, river views, lush greenery
- Best Time to Visit: Early morning for a refreshing walk
Bund Garden is a well-maintained park located near the Mula-Mutha River. It’s a great place for a morning walk or a boat ride, offering a scenic view of the river and surrounding greenery. The park’s tranquility and lush surroundings make it an ideal place to unwind, especially during the cooler January months.
9. Raja Dinkar Kelkar Museum

- Highlights: Indian artifacts, historical collections, cultural heritage
- Best Time to Visit: Afternoon for a detailed tour
Raja Dinkar Kelkar Museum is a fascinating place to visit for those interested in Indian culture and history. The museum houses an extensive collection of artifacts, including musical instruments, pottery, sculptures, and textiles. It provides a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of India and is a great place to explore during your January trip to Pune.
10. Fergusson College

- Highlights: Colonial architecture, cultural events, green campus
- Best Time to Visit: Afternoon for a relaxed walk
Fergusson College is one of Pune’s oldest and most prestigious educational institutions, known for its beautiful colonial-era architecture and lush green campus. The college grounds are open to visitors, and January’s mild weather makes it perfect for a leisurely stroll through the campus. The college also hosts various cultural and academic events throughout the year.
